
**股票交易系统卡顿崩溃?看这案例如何高效解决并优化成果**线上靠谱正规配资
在股票交易的高峰时段,系统突然卡顿甚至崩溃,是每个券商和交易员都不愿面对的噩梦。交易延迟可能导致客户流失、资金损失,甚至引发监管风险。某头部券商就曾因系统卡顿在开盘时段丢失大量订单,直接经济损失超百万元,客户投诉量激增。如何快速定位问题、高效解决并实现长期优化?以下结合真实案例,分享4个关键方法。
---
### **方法1:紧急扩容:快速“止血”,恢复基础服务**
**问题场景**:当系统卡顿时,最直观的原因是服务器负载过高,无法处理突发流量。
**解决步骤**:
1. **实时监控告警**:通过监控工具(如Prometheus、Grafana)快速定位卡顿时段CPU、内存、磁盘I/O的峰值。
2. **动态扩容**:立即启用云服务器的弹性扩容功能(如阿里云ECS、AWS EC2),或调用备用服务器集群,分散请求压力。
3. **流量削峰**:对非核心功能(如历史数据查询)进行限流,优先保障交易订单处理。
**案例效果**:某券商在扩容后,系统响应时间从5秒降至200毫秒,订单处理能力提升3倍,成功扛住当日开盘峰值流量。
### **方法2:代码优化:从根源解决性能瓶颈**
**问题场景**:系统架构设计不合理或代码存在低效逻辑,导致资源浪费。
**解决步骤**:
1. **性能分析**:使用工具(如JProfiler、Arthas)定位耗时最长的代码模块,例如某券商发现订单匹配算法的时间复杂度为O(n²),导致处理10万订单时卡顿。
2. **重构优化**:将算法优化为O(n log n),并减少数据库查询次数(如用缓存替代实时查询)。
3. **异步处理**:将非实时操作(如日志记录、邮件通知)改为异步任务,释放主线程资源。
**案例效果**:优化后,订单处理速度提升10倍,系统卡顿频率从每日3次降至0次。
### **方法3:数据库调优:打破数据读写瓶颈**
**问题场景**:数据库查询慢、连接数不足是交易系统的常见痛点。
**解决步骤**:
1. **索引优化**:为高频查询字段(如股票代码、用户ID)添加索引,减少全表扫描。
2. **读写分离**:将读操作分流到从库,主库专注写操作(如订单插入)。
3. **分库分表**:对大表(如历史交易记录)按时间或用户ID分片,降低单表压力。
**案例效果**:某券商通过分库分表,将单表数据量从1亿条降至千万级,查询速度提升5倍。
### **方法4:全链路压测:提前预防,未雨绸缪**
**问题场景**:系统上线前未充分测试,导致实际流量超出预期时崩溃。
**解决步骤**:
1. **模拟真实场景**:使用工具(如JMeter、Locust)模拟开盘、收盘等高峰时段的并发请求。
2. **逐步加压**:从低并发开始,逐步提升至预期流量的2倍,观察系统瓶颈(如连接池耗尽、线程阻塞)。
3. **优化验证**:根据压测结果调整参数(如线程池大小、缓存策略),并重复测试直至稳定。
**案例效果**:某券商通过压测发现缓存穿透问题,优化后系统在双倍流量下仍保持稳定。
---
### **总结:解决卡顿崩溃的3个关键点**
1. **快速响应**:通过监控和扩容第一时间恢复服务,减少损失。
2. **深度优化**:从代码、数据库到架构,层层排查性能瓶颈。
3. **预防为主**:通过全链路压测提前发现风险,避免重复踩坑。
股票交易系统的稳定性是生命线线上靠谱正规配资,一次卡顿可能毁掉多年积累的客户信任。通过“紧急扩容+代码优化+数据库调优+全链路压测”的组合拳,既能快速解决问题,也能构建长期健壮的系统。希望这些经验能帮你少走弯路,让交易更流畅!
元鼎证券_股票配资杠杆官网_线上实盘配资平台提示:本文来自互联网,不代表本网站观点。